1) Chef Joe has 8 lb 4 oz of ground beef in his freezer. This is ⅓ of the amount needed
to make the number of burgers he planned for a party. If he uses 4 oz of beef for each
burger, how many burgers is he planning to make? Justify your answer with equations
and a visual model.
8 lbs 4 oz x 3 = 24 lbs 12 oz
24 lb x 16 = 384 oz
384 oz + 12 oz = 396 oz
Number of burgers = B
396 ÷ 4 = B
99 = B
2) Diego and Charley have three dogs. Diesel weighs 89 pounds 12 ounces. Ebony
weighs 33 pounds 14 ounces less than Diesel. Luna is the smallest at 10 pounds 2
ounces. What is the combined weight of the three dogs? Justify your answer with
equations and a visual model.
Diesel’s weight = D
89 lbs x 16 = 1,424 oz
1,424 oz + 12 oz = D
1,436 oz = D
Ebony’s weight = E
33 lbs x 16 = 528 oz
528 oz + 14 oz = 542 oz
1,436 oz - 542 oz = E
894 oz = E
Luna’s weight = L
10 lbs x 16 = 160 lbs
160 lbs + 2 oz = L
162 oz = L
Total weight = W
1,436 oz + 894 oz + 162 oz = W
2,492 oz = W
3) Five ounces of pretzels are put into each bag. How many full bags can be made
from 22 ¾ pounds of pretzels? Justify your answer with equations and a visual model.
22 lbs x 16 = 352 oz
¾ lb = 12 oz
352 oz + 12 oz = 364 oz
Number of bags = B
364 oz ÷ 5 oz = B
72 r4 = B
You will be able to fill 72 full bags of pretzel dough. There will be 4 ounces left
over.
